Lexington, Illinois is a small town located in McLean County, with a population of approximately 2,000 people. The town is situated just off Interstate 55, making it easily accessible for both residents and visitors. Lexington is known for its rich history, small-town charm, and strong sense of community.

Founded in 1836, Lexington has a deep and vibrant history. The town was a key stop on the historic Route 66, and many of its historic buildings and landmarks from that time can still be seen today. The town also has a strong agricultural heritage, with many residents involved in farming and agriculture. Lexington is home to the annual Midsommar Festival, a celebration of the town’s Swedish heritage, which includes a parade, carnival, and traditional Swedish food and music.

Despite its small size, Lexington has a thriving local community. The town has a strong network of local businesses, including shops, restaurants, and services, where residents can find everything they need without having to venture far from home. The close-knit community is evident in the many community events and activities that take place throughout the year, such as the annual Christmas parade, Fourth of July fireworks, and community sports leagues.

Lexington offers residents and visitors ample opportunities for outdoor recreation. The nearby Lake Bloomington provides opportunities for boating, fishing, and swimming, while the surrounding countryside offers beautiful scenery for hiking, biking, and picnicking. The town also has several parks and playgrounds, making it a great place for families with young children.
